Do Americans live in a "nanny state"? Is the "freedom to ingest" equal to the "right to keep and bear arms"? What does the Constitution really say about gun ownership and the legality of marijuana? This challenging documentary filmed in Wyoming and Colorado entertainingly explores these two contentious issues with a heady mix of animation, fake news footage, interviews, and music videos. 99 min. Widescreen; Soundtrack: English; deleted scenes; "making of" featurette; theatrical trailer.
